The speed of the 0.43kg soccer ball is approximately 13.4 m/s.

To find the speed of a 0.43 kg soccer ball given a kinetic energy of 38.6 J, we can use the kinetic energy formula:

K.E = 1/2mv²

where:

  • K.E is the kinetic energy (38.6 Joules)
  • m is the mass of the ball (0.43 kg)
  • v is the speed of the ball (which we need to find)


1. First, rearrange the formula to solve for v:
v = √((2K.E)/m)


2. Now, substitute the given values into the equation:
v = √((2 × 38.6)/0.43)

3. Next, calculate the values inside the square root:
v = √(77.2/0.43)
v = √79.53


4. Finally, take the square root:
v ≈ 13.4 m/s


So, the speed of the ball is approximately 13.4 meters per second.
